MalaysiaAll rooms are only accessible by steps thus are not suitable for those on wheelchairs. The family room that we've stayed in has very steep stairs to the room upstairs that we ended up sleeping on the big bed downstairs. There's no chair in the room and the bathroom floor can be chilly and minimum partition between the toilet and shower area may resulted in some water from.one area can spill into the other. It would be great to have toilet paper and toilet odouriser or perfume in the toilet - shower area. It's better to make own arrangement for anyone travelling without own car as it might be difficult to find good car and driver to go around Sembalun or to travel to other areas in Lombok. The focal suggested by Bale Aur does not seem to be focused or interested in arranging transportation.
The location. Is superb as it's facing beautiful mountains and just opposite of beautiful Teras Sawah and nearby tourists locations such as Kedai Sawah, Kebun Bunga, Bukit Selum etc by rental car. It's in front of main road but it's quite enough . The room have small seating area in front and there are nearby restaurant along the road within 5 - 10i minutes walk. The bathroom comes with water heater which is great for the mountainous area. The view from the bed with large floor to ceiling window is great though it can be hot during the day as the room is facing the sun during the day and there's no fan or aircond in the room.

RomaniaHowever, the facilities are quite basic. The A-frame cabins offer a unique experience, but you can hear everything from your neighbors below or above. If you stay upstairs, you'll enjoy a beautiful balcony with a breathtaking view, but be prepared for a mattress on the floor instead of a bed. The bathroom is also downstairs, which means you'll have to climb up and down each time you need it. Additionally, there's no sink in the bathroom. One thing to note is that you will hear the mosques several times a day, including during the night, so earplugs are a must for a good night's sleep. Overall, it's a charming place with a few quirks. If you’re looking for basic accommodation with stunning views and friendly hosts, this could be a good choice.
I recently stayed at an accommodation in Sembalun village, Lombok, and had a pleasant experience overall. The hosts were very nice and friendly, although they only knew basic English words, so communication was limited. They were extremely helpful, arranging a scooter rental for just 100 rupees per day and assisting with our transfer to Kuta at the end of our stay. The location is great, situated on the main road with an amazing view over the rice and vegetable plantations and mountains. Breakfast was delicious and included in the price, which was a nice touch.
